Here is some coffee - espresso intel for Regina, Saskatchewan. Things are looking up! ----begin intel Apparently there are 3 coffee 'hoods in Regina: the downtown, cathedral, and south end, Roca Jack's used to be Regina's best. Apparently it has declined in the past few years. The coffee is still freshly roasted and not too bad. There is one downtown on Scarth and one on 13th just off Albert. For good coffee downtown there is Abstractions on Rose and Muddy Joe's, on Hamilton. In Cathedral district, there is Cafe Orange and the 13th ave Coffee House. Good coffee and Great food? Check out 13th ave coffee house.
